<img height="1" width="1" style="display:none" src="https://www.facebook.com/tr?id=612681139262614&amp;ev=PageView&amp;noscript=1">
Skip to content

Need help? Talk to an expert: phone(904) 638-5743

What is Snowflake? And Why It's Changing the GAME! (Cloud Data Warehousing Explained)

What is Snowflake? And Why It's Changing the GAME! (Cloud Data Warehousing Explained)

In the first episode of the "Let It Snow" series by Pragmatic Works, instructor Greg Trzeciak introduces the fundamentals of Snowflake—a revolutionary cloud-native data warehousing platform. This video lays the groundwork for understanding how Snowflake is transforming data infrastructure and why organizations are making the shift from traditional on-premises servers.

 

From Traditional Servers to Cloud-Native Platforms

Greg begins by looking back at the limitations of the “dinosaur server age,” where companies relied on on-premises infrastructure. These systems were costly, slow to scale, and difficult to maintain. Upgrades required lengthy procurement processes, and it was nearly impossible to predict future storage or compute needs accurately.

Snowflake emerged as a solution to these issues by offering a fully managed, cloud-native architecture. This allows users to scale up or down as needed and only pay for the resources they use—an efficient and cost-effective alternative to traditional servers.

What Makes Snowflake Unique?

Greg highlights several key differentiators that make Snowflake stand out in the data warehousing space:

  • Separation of Storage and Compute: This means users can optimize costs based on specific needs, whether they require more compute power or more storage capacity.
  • Multiclustering and Scalability: Users can run complex queries on large or extra-large virtual warehouses for faster processing, or opt for smaller ones to save costs.
  • Pay-as-you-go Pricing: You only pay for the compute resources used during query execution, not idle time.
  • Cross-Platform Compatibility: Built on AWS, Azure, and Google Cloud, Snowflake supports deployment across global infrastructures.

Key Features and Capabilities

Snowflake is designed to handle a wide array of use cases across industries. Some of the notable features include:

  • Time Travel: Enables recovery of data from previous states, ideal for disaster recovery.
  • Zero Copy Cloning: Allows developers to clone databases instantly without consuming extra storage.
  • Role-Based Access Control: Ensures secure data sharing and governance through customizable user roles.
  • Flexible Programming Support: Work with SQL, Python, or Snowpark based on your preference.

Use Cases and Applications

According to Greg, Snowflake supports a broad spectrum of data-related tasks, including:

  1. Business Intelligence and Reporting
  2. Machine Learning and AI Integration
  3. Data Transformation and Pipeline Creation
  4. Collaborative Data Sharing
  5. Data Science and Analytics

Whether you're analyzing education data, healthcare records, or logistics, Snowflake offers the flexibility and power needed to drive business insights effectively.

Integrations with Popular Tools

Snowflake integrates seamlessly with popular BI tools and programming environments:

  • Power BI
  • Tableau
  • Looker
  • Python
  • SQL

This makes it easier for users to visualize data, build models, and collaborate across teams using familiar tools.

Global Reach and Marketplace

Snowflake operates globally, allowing businesses to deploy solutions close to their users—whether in the U.S., South Korea, or anywhere else. Its marketplace supports live data sharing and third-party datasets. Greg even shares a use case where he explored how weather data could correlate with sales trends.

Getting Started with Snowflake

In summary, Snowflake offers a modern, scalable, and cost-effective solution for managing and analyzing data. Its user-friendly ecosystem, rich feature set, and global reach make it a top choice for organizations ready to embrace the future of cloud data warehousing.

Don't forget to check out the Pragmatic Works' on-demand learning platform for more insightful content and training sessions on [TECHNOLOGY DISCUSSED IN BLOG POST] and other Microsoft applications. Be sure to subscribe to the Pragmatic Works YouTube channel to stay up-to-date on the latest tips and tricks. 

Sign-up now and get instant access

Leave a comment

Free Community Plan

On-demand learning

Most Recent

private training

Hackathons, enterprise training, virtual monitoring